I'm working on the addition of an Inquis to my group instead of a fury, and I'm having a hell of a time with [what I believe to be] positional nonsense - or simply stated I can't get her to cast them a lot of the time (she'll just "sit there" until a spell of something comes available). The CA's in the Inquisitor AA tree that replace spells have a modifier on them (green text when examined) that adds additional damage when the caster is flanking or behind the mob. When my inquis does get behind the mob, suddenly she'll burn through all the CA's, but if she's facing them she ignores all of them. This is a problem because the CA's themselves are not position dependent - you only don't get the bonus damage if you're not flanking or behind. I suspect ogre bot is misinterpreting these as flanking / rear only like with typical scout CA's and skipping them.

Of course, the problem is that Inquis is shit DPS without those CA's and rear positioning isn't always available. I've looked through the options and I don't see anything obvious that would tell ogre bot to ignore flanking / positional rules; any advice?

Sorry for the quick follow up; I just verified this behavior on an epic training dummy. If the Inquisitor faces the dummy, it will not cast:

Strike of Corruption
Writhing Strike
Invocation Strike
Strike of Flames

EDIT: I just found the 'cause' - if you look at the ability export XML file, the abilities attribute ReqFlanking is set to "TRUE" :

<Setting Name="Writhing Strike" AbilityLineID="2138638112" ID="2138638112" PowerCost="93" MainIconID="182" RecastTime="6.000000" DissonanceCostPerTick="0" MagicDmg="TRUE" DoesDmg="TRUE" ReqFlanking="TRUE" MeleeDmg="TRUE" MentalDmg="TRUE" IsSingleTargetAbility="TRUE" TargetType="1" MinRange="0.000000" SavageryCost="0" HOIconID="14" MaxDuration="10.800000" HealthCostPerTick="0" MaxAOETargets="0" SpellBookType="1" MaxRange="10.000000" DissonanceCost="0" CastingTime="0.250000" PowerCostPerTick="0" DoesNotExpire="FALSE" GroupRestricted="FALSE" EffectRadius="0.000000" IsBeneficial="FALSE" HealthCost="0" ConcentrationCost="0" RecoveryTime="0.350000" NumClasses="0" SavageryCostPerTick="0" BackDropIconID="315" AllowRaid="FALSE" Range="10.000000" IsASingleTargetHostile="TRUE">Writhing Strike</Setting>

I can manually edit this file every time I export, but I suspect you'll want to investigate if there is a smoother way to handle this (if you care about Inquisitor DPS / debuffs :) ).
